One thing I notice is when you use the comma for the actual sort, it will use whatever is after the comma, example.
Brooks, Garth & Trisha Yearwood - this is VERY common among the database listings. HOWEVER if you want to list it as first name last name, it will list as
Garth & Trisha Yearwood Brooks. This one you HAVE to edit as
Brooks & Trisha Yearwood, Garth in order for it to read
Garth Brooks & Trisha Yearwood. There is no other way around it. And if there are more than 1 comma in the line ie multiple artists then it really messes the line up if you want it First name Last name. If you could fix this to truly work, that would be great, however the only workaround I have found to work is actually editing all the artists.

We have an engineering problem. :e :s

Since the Artist fields contain both last and first names, we do not have sort access to order them by first or last name as I proposed above. To accomplish this would require building an array in RAM then running a sort on the [last], [first] fields within the [name] field.

After evaluating this from the code level, this turned into a "large" project that we cannot justify at this time. I've got it in our spec to do when we get a break.
